Metal Compression Spring

Updated: 2026-07-15

Overview

Metal compression springs are helical springs that resist compressive forces and return to their original length when the force is removed. They are fundamental components in mechanical systems, offering reliable energy storage and shock absorption. These springs are manufactured from materials like high-carbon steel or stainless steel, chosen for their strength and resilience. Their design can be customized to meet specific load and space requirements, making them versatile for diverse industrial applications.

Structure and Working Principle

A metal compression spring typically consists of a tightly wound helix with uniform pitch. When compressed, the spring stores potential energy, which is released upon decompression. The spring's performance depends on wire diameter, coil count, and material properties. Engineers use Hooke’s Law (F = kx) to calculate force resistance, where 'k' is the spring constant. Proper design ensures optimal functionality without permanent deformation.

Key Features

Metal compression springs excel in durability and adaptability. High-carbon steel variants offer superior strength, while stainless steel resists corrosion in harsh environments. Custom coatings (e.g., zinc plating) enhance longevity. These springs maintain consistent performance across temperature fluctuations and repeated cycles, making them ideal for high-stress applications like automotive suspensions or heavy machinery.

Application Areas

These springs are ubiquitous in automotive systems (e.g., clutch assemblies), industrial equipment (e.g., presses), and consumer goods (e.g., pens). They also serve critical roles in aerospace and medical devices. In B2B contexts, bulk procurement is common for manufacturing lines or replacement parts. Their scalability allows integration into both small-scale gadgets and large industrial systems.

Maintenance and Precautions

Regular inspection for wear, rust, or deformation is essential. Lubrication reduces friction in dynamic applications, while proper storage prevents misalignment. Avoid exceeding the spring’s maximum compression limit, as this can cause permanent damage. Ensure installation aligns with the spring’s axis to prevent buckling or uneven force distribution.

B2B Procurement Guide

When sourcing metal compression springs, specify material grade, dimensions (free length, outer diameter), and load capacity. MOQs vary by supplier; bulk orders often reduce unit costs. Partner with ISO-certified manufacturers for quality assurance. Lead times typically range from 2-6 weeks for custom orders. Sample testing is recommended to verify compliance with technical specifications.
